Transaction e7d8776082a5072d505904a5a4dc995690f254779a85954aecfe026e76598d2f

7 Input
2 Outputs
  • e7d8776082a5072d505904a5a4dc995690f254779a85954aecfe026e76598d2f:0
  • value  40458
    address  172LohRAdPGafb1Xy9BeDDSCZ5hcgjHsyH
  • e7d8776082a5072d505904a5a4dc995690f254779a85954aecfe026e76598d2f:1
  • value  75933239
    address  35jPYRhi7sFGEQkBi68t5Fo92YhV7wovBv